Semrush: The All-in-One Solution

Semrush stands out as a comprehensive yet approachable SEO platform for B2B companies of all sizes. Its strength lies in providing enterprise-level capabilities through an interface that doesn’t require specialized knowledge to navigate effectively.

The keyword research functionality within Semrush is particularly valuable for B2B marketers. It offers detailed information about search volume, difficulty, and competitive positioning, while also suggesting related terms that might be easier to rank for.

Semrush’s Position Tracking feature allows you to monitor your rankings for specific keywords over time, providing clear visibility into your SEO progress. This makes it easy to demonstrate ROI to stakeholders and identify opportunities for improvement.

The Site Audit tool automatically identifies technical SEO issues that might be hindering your performance, then categorizes them by priority level. This approach helps non-technical users focus on the most impactful fixes rather than getting lost in minor details. Ahrefs: Simplified Competitive Analysis

Ahrefs delivers powerful competitive intelligence through an interface that makes complex SEO concepts accessible to B2B marketers without extensive technical backgrounds. Its strengths particularly benefit teams focusing on content-driven SEO strategies.

The Site Explorer feature provides a comprehensive view of any website’s SEO performance, including organic traffic estimates, top-performing pages, and backlink profiles. This information is invaluable for understanding what’s working for competitors in your industry.

Content Gap analysis identifies keywords your competitors rank for that your site doesn’t, revealing immediate opportunities to expand your content strategy. This data-driven approach helps B2B companies prioritize content creation efforts for maximum impact.

Ahrefs’ Keyword Explorer offers in-depth metrics on search terms relevant to your business, including "clicks per search" data that shows how many people actually click on results versus finding answers directly in search snippets. This nuanced understanding helps you target keywords with genuine traffic potential rather than just high search volumes.

Google’s Free SEO Tools Suite

Google offers a collection of free tools that provide remarkable value for B2B companies looking to improve their search presence without additional investment. These official Google resources deliver insights directly from the search engine that processes the majority of web searches.

Google Search Console provides essential data about how your website performs in search results, including which queries trigger your listings, your average position, and click-through rates. The Coverage report helps identify technical issues that might prevent proper indexing of your content.

Google Analytics works seamlessly with Search Console to show what visitors do after arriving on your site from search results. This conversion tracking capability is crucial for B2B companies focused on generating leads rather than just traffic.

Google Trends offers valuable context about seasonal fluctuations and long-term interest in topics relevant to your business. This information helps inform content calendars and resource allocation for maximum impact. AnswerThePublic: Question-Based Keyword Research

AnswerThePublic offers a refreshingly different approach to keyword research by focusing specifically on the questions people ask about any given topic. For B2B companies, this question-focused perspective provides invaluable insights into customer pain points and information needs.

The visual "search cloud" presents questions organized by question words (who, what, when, where, why, how), making it easy to identify patterns in how potential customers think about your products or services. This organization helps marketers quickly spot content gaps and opportunities.

The comparison feature reveals how people evaluate options in your industry by showing searches that include terms like "versus," "compared to," and "or." This competitive intelligence helps shape messaging that directly addresses customer decision criteria.

Preposition-based searches (like "for small business" or "with limited budget") provide context about specific user segments and use cases. This granular understanding helps B2B companies create highly targeted content for different buyer personas at various stages of the purchasing journey.

Measuring SEO Success for B2B Companies

Effective measurement is essential for demonstrating the value of SEO investments and guiding ongoing optimization efforts. For B2B companies, this means looking beyond basic traffic metrics to focus on business impact.

Lead quality indicators like time-to-conversion, deal size, and close rate provide more meaningful insights than raw lead counts. Tracking these metrics helps determine which keywords and content types attract your ideal customers rather than just generating volume.

Engagement metrics such as time on page, return visits, and resource downloads indicate how effectively your content addresses buyer needs at different funnel stages. These behavioral signals help refine content strategy for maximum impact.
